A little bit on the style: I wanted to go with something different because I always wore my skirt to the club. I wanted to bring out something different. I paired my skirt with an old crop top from ASOS for the simple or traditional aspect. I brought out my favorite red pumps for the POP. Then to set it off with my Old Navy army fatigue jacket for the 'dare' of it all. Loved it.
